Purpose & Capability
Name/description match the requested items (jq/awk for JSON processing and SkillBoss_API_KEY for calling SkillBoss API) which is reasonable for an LLM-based emotion encoder. However the SKILL.md heavily references local scripts (install.sh, encode-pipeline.sh, etc.) that are not present in the skill bundle and there is no install spec to fetch them; that mismatch reduces transparency and is unexpected.
!
Instruction Scope
Instructions tell the agent to install scripts, set up crons, extract 'new signals' from conversation history, and call SkillBoss API (/v1/pilot). This means private conversation transcripts or session history will be processed and sent to an external endpoint automatically. The SKILL.md also instructs creating AMYGDALA_STATE.md which OpenClaw will auto-inject into future sessions — altering agent behavior without per-session consent.
!
Install Mechanism
There is no install spec and no code files in the package, yet SKILL.md instructs running install.sh and other scripts. That inconsistency forces you to either obtain code from the referenced GitHub repo or run a locally-provided install script that doesn't exist in this bundle. Lack of a clear, included, auditable install mechanism is a risk.
Credentials
Only SkillBoss_API_KEY and standard CLI tools (jq, awk) are required — this is proportionate to calling an external emotion-detection service. But the skill will use that API key to transmit conversation content and derived emotional data; treat that key as sensitive and ensure its scope/permissions and the trustworthiness of the SkillBoss service before granting it.
!
Persistence & Privilege
Although always:false, the skill instructs creating cron jobs to run periodically (every 3–6 hours) and generating an AMYGDALA_STATE.md that OpenClaw auto-injects into sessions. That grants ongoing, autonomous influence over agent responses and creates a persistent data flow (periodic reads + external API calls). Cron setup and auto-injection materially increase the attack surface and persistence.
What to consider before installing
This skill is potentially useful for adding persistent emotional state, but exercise caution. Key points to consider before installing: 1) The package contains only a SKILL.md but references many scripts (install.sh, encode-pipeline.sh, etc.) that are not included — ask the publisher for the actual code or an install spec and review it thoroughly. 2) The encode pipeline will read conversation transcripts and send them to SkillBoss API using SkillBoss_API_KEY — do not provide this key unless you trust the service and have verified its privacy and retention policies; prefer a scoped, revocable key. 3) The install instructions set up cron jobs that will run automatically and update an AMYGDALA_STATE.md which is auto-injected into future sessions—this means the skill will change agent behavior across sessions without per-session consent. If you want the feature but want lower risk: request the scripts, review them locally, run the encode pipeline manually instead of installing cron, or sandbox the skill (use a restricted API key or an intercepting proxy to inspect payloads). If you cannot review the code or trust the external API, avoid installing the cron/auto-sync features and do not supply your production API key.

The Solution

Track five emotional dimensions that persist and decay over time:

DimensionWhat It MeasuresRange
ValencePositive ? Negative mood-1.0 to 1.0
ArousalCalm ? Excited/Alert0.0 to 1.0
ConnectionDistant ? Close/Bonded0.0 to 1.0
CuriosityBored ? Fascinated0.0 to 1.0
EnergyDepleted ? Energized0.0 to 1.0

Auto-Injection (Zero Manual Steps!)

After install, AMYGDALA_STATE.md is created in your workspace root.

OpenClaw automatically injects all *.md files from workspace into session context. This means:

  1. New session starts
  2. AMYGDALA_STATE.md is auto-loaded (no manual step!)
  3. You see your emotional state in context
  4. Responses are influenced by your mood

The file is regenerated whenever decay-emotion.sh runs (via cron every 6h).

Decay Mechanics

Emotions naturally return to baseline over time:

  • Decay rate: 10% of distance to baseline per run
  • Recommended schedule: Every 6 hours
  • Effect: Strong emotions fade, but slowly

After 24 hours without updates, a valence of 0.8 would decay to ~0.65.
